I have a 6800k, titan XP and a rampage 10.

My first 6800k was a poor clocker and struggled to reach 4.2, back in september i had to rma it because of a issue and intel suggested to replace the cpu. My new one will happily bench at 4.6, and fully stable at 4.5. I run it at 4.4 generally with some 3200 mhz ram and cache at 34.

Whilst you might have a better chance of a better clocker with the 6850k its really isnt worth the extra unless you need the extra lanes.
